Chicago Cubs 2010 MLB Predictions
March 14, 2010
On a bright note, the Chicago Cubs did finish with a winning record for a third straight season last year, going 83-78. It was the first time a Cubs’ team has done that since the early 1970’s. But the curse is still there, and it has now been more than 100 years since this team has won a World Series. Chicago had several big names suffer dips in production last year. Cubs Sign Byrd to Fill Hole in Center Field
January 3, 2010
It has been a pretty quiet offseason for the Chicago Cubs, as the Cubs only real move had been trading away Milton Bradley. Letting Bradley go made the Cubs need for a center fielder a big concern, but as CBS Sports is reporting the Cubs have signed outfielder Marlon Byrd to a 3-year $15 million dollar contract. 2009 Chicago Cubs Predictions
February 25, 2009
The Chicago Cubs failed to win a World Series for the 100th straight season, and while the Cubs won the NL Central for the second straight season, going an impressive 97-64, the disappointing showing in the postseason against the Los Angeles Dodgers is all that remains on the Cubs’ minds after failing to win a playoff game for the second straight year.
